POLOKWANE – Residents in the city are getting a taste of summer this week as warm to hot conditions are expected.
AccuWeather’s forecast suggests maximum temperatures of up to 33ºC this week, cooling down to 23ºC over the weekend.
Monday to Wednesday will see highs of between 30ºC and 33ºC before a drop in temperature on Thursday.
Temperatures will then warm up again on Friday before cooling down once again on Sunday to a high of 23ºC.
Sunny conditions will persist throughout the week and AccuWeather has advised caution if doing strenuous activities outside on Wednesday due to hot temperatures.
Little to no rain is expected in the city and minimum temperatures will range from 4ºC to 16ºC.
